INT-2681 — Ethical Hacking Certification Preparation

3 credits · 3 hours

This course provides an understanding of how to ethically and effectively assess an organization’s security posture from threat agents. This course is designed for those interested in penetration testing and vulnerability assessment, or who want to take the EC-Council’s Certified Ethical Hacker (CEH) exam. Formerly: This course replaces both INT-1680 and INT-2680. Students who have completed INT-1680 must take this course, INT-2861. Students may not receive credit for both INT-2680 and INT-2681.
